// MAX_UNDO_DEPTH: how many steps the Sketchloom editor keeps in its
// undo stack. Bumping this past ~200 makes large diagrams chew memory,
// since we snapshot full node state per step (yes, we should diff —
// see the backlog). Redo shares the same budget. Any change here must
// cite the benchmark run whose trace token appears below.

pipeline stamp: htk6_35e0c9

TICKET-4412: Nightly backfill scheduler (Driftwell) failing since 02:00. Root cause: the service credential used by the backfill runner expired and was never auto-renewed. Plugin authors: jobs queued against Driftwell will retry once the credential is replaced. No plugin-side changes required. A fresh credential has been issued for the internal backfill API and is provided below.

app token of kagap-fahag = zpat2_0m

Ticket #— Wellness room booking, Floor 5

Hey facilities! Quick one from the Orenna Systems assistant pool. We've got the Floor 5 wellness room booked Thursdays 12–2 for the quiet-hours pilot, but the booking panel outside keeps showing it as free and people keep walking in. Can someone fix the display? Also, the door auto-locks between sessions now, so whoever opens up needs the keypad code, which I'm pasting below for reference.

door code, tagef-bajop: bdg-SB-7